Cerrowire Alabama MC Cable Investment Drives U.S. Growth

Cerrowire, a leading U.S. manufacturer of copper building wire, announced aย $100 million investmentย in a newย 270,000-square-foot facilityย inย Hartselle, Alabama. The project will produceย metal-clad (MC) cable, a fast-growing product in commercial and industrial construction.

Thisย Cerrowire Alabama MC cable investmentย supports nationwide demand for safe, efficient wiring and marks a major milestone as the company celebrates its 100th anniversary.

Creating Jobs and Strengthening the Community

The new Hartselle plant will createย more than 130 jobs, boosting local employment and economic growth. Cerrowire chose theย Morgan Center Business Parkย for its business-friendly location and strong community partnerships.

โ€œWeโ€™re proud to make Hartselle the home of this important expansion,โ€ saidย Stewart Smallwood, Cerrowire President. โ€œThis investment helps us grow while contributing to the people and economy of North Alabama.โ€

He praised theย State of Alabama,ย Morgan County, theย Tennessee Valley Authority, and theย City of Hartselleย for providing outstanding support and helping the project succeed.

Meeting Growing Demand for MC Cable

Theย Cerrowire Alabama MC cable investmentย positions the company to meet the rising need for advanced electrical wiring. The MC cable market continues to expand acrossย commercial,ย industrial, andย residentialย sectors because of its reliability and easy installation.

Unlike traditional wiring, MC cable uses durableย metal claddingย that complies withย National Electrical Code (NEC)ย standards. Itโ€™s ideal forย data centers, hospitals, andย modern construction projectsย where safety and efficiency matter most.

Strengthening U.S. Manufacturing Leadership

Headquartered inย Hartselle, Alabama, Cerrowire operates additional plants inย Georgia,ย Indiana, andย Utah. As part of theย Marmon Electrical Groupโ€”aย Berkshire Hathaway companyโ€”Cerrowire continues to invest in technology, workforce development, and sustainable production.

Through thisย Cerrowire Alabama MC cable investment, the company reinforces its commitment to U.S. manufacturing and positions itself for long-term growth in the electrical industry.
